Installation
Instructions
INSTALLATION - it is as easy as
1-2-3

Step 1) Configure the Script
Using
a text editor like textpad, or notepad, open the config.cgi script and
make changes to the variables. Save your changes.
A ) Type the URL address of the swars.cgi
EXAMPLE
$scriptpath="http://www.yourdomain.com/cgi-bin/swars.cgi";
B
)Type the full path to your Mail program. If you're not sure of this, ask
your server administrator
EXAMPLE
$mailprog="/usr/lib/sendmail";
C
) Type your email address. Make sure # to place a
\ in front of the @ symbol
EXAMPLE
$fromaddr="webmaster\@yourdomain.com";
D
) This is the file that will hold all of the email addresses and names of
all of your autoresponders. Change it to something more secretive or leave it
as is.
EXAMPLE
$mbase = "collect.txt"; E
) Type a default name. If the system is unable to extract the prospect's
name, it will print the Default Name. This step is also optional
EXAMPLE
$emptyuname="Friend"; F
) Enter the Admin password (case sensitive 8 chars max)
EXAMPLE
$password="demo";
Step 2) Upload the files
Upload the following files to your cgi-bin directory.
- swars.cgi
- config.cgi
- activate.cgi
- Lite.pm
ATTENTION! ALL files must be uploaded as ASCII files. If you upload as
binary, it WONT work. 
Step 3) Set Permissions
- Set the permissions for the swars.cgi file to '755'
- Set the permissions for the config.cgi file to '755'
- Set the permissions for the activate.cgi file to '755'
- Set the permissions for the Lite.pm file to '644'
Step 4) Set Script Activation
FollowUp
works without CRON jobs (which are not allowed on many servers). You
place a 1-pixel "image" on a well viewed web page, which activates the
script periodically. If there even one visitor a day it will work fine. When activated, it checks and sees if it needs to send an e-mail to your contacts.

The syntax of the activation image follows:
<img src="http://www.yourdomain.com/cgi-bin/activate.cgi"
width="1" height="1" border="0">
You can even place the
activation image on another domain. It will activate the script every time somebody visits that page. However, in my experience, I suggest that you place
it on the entry page to your site.
Step 4) Log in Start Working
Now
login to the admin area using the password you specified in the config.cgi and
start working. To run the admin area, just point your browser to the swars.cgi
EXAMPLE http://www.yourdomain.com/cgi-bin/swars.cgi
